New Assemblyman Michael Cashman on Priorities for the 2026 Legislative Session

With the New Year and new Legislative Session getting underway this week in Albany, we sit down with the North Country’s new Assemblyman, Michael Cashman, who is beginning his first year representing New York’s 115th Assembly District that covers all of Clinton and Franklin Counties and 5 Towns in Essex County. We talk about two bills that Assemblyman Cashman has already introduced as well as his priorities as he and his fellow state lawmakers begin the new session. Mr. Cashman is also planning to hold several town hall meetings in the next few weeks.
